Indian village celebrates end of Diwali with cow dung fight

Dozens of villagers in Gummatapura, southern India, hurl cow dung at each other for the Gorehabba festival — a local ritual marking the end of Diwali. Devotees believe their deity Beereshwara Swamy was born in cow excrement, which many Hindus consider sacred and purifying.
